Executive Order 11063 Clause Samples

Executive Order 11063 is a federal directive that prohibits discrimination in the sale, leasing, rental, or other disposition of properties and facilities owned or operated by the federal government or provided with federal funds. In practice, this means that any housing or related facilities that receive federal assistance must be made available without regard to race, color, religion, or national origin. For example, a federally funded apartment complex cannot refuse to rent to someone based on their ethnicity. The core function of this order is to promote equal opportunity in housing and prevent discriminatory practices in federally involved real estate transactions.

Executive Order 11063. This executive order provides that no person shall be discriminated against on the basis of race, color, religion, sex, or national origin in housing and related facilities provided with federal assistance and lending practices with respect to residential property when such practices are connected with loans insured or guaranteed by the federal government.
Executive Order 11063. The City shall comply with Executive Order 11063 as amended by Executive Order 12259 and as contained in 24 CFR Part 107. City will take all action necessary and appropriate to prevent discrimination because of race, color, religion (creed), sex, or national origin, in the sale leasing, rental, or other disposition of residential property and related facilities (including land to be developed for residential use), or in the use or occupancy thereof, if such property and related facilities area, among other things, provided in whole or in part with the aid of loans, advances, grants, or contributions agreed to be made by the Federal Government.
